Multi-center,Prospective, Randomized Trial ToDemonstrate Improved Metabolic Control of PEN VS Dianeal In Diabetic CAPD and APD Patients - The Impendia Trial

研究概览

简要总结

Primary Objective: To demonstrate that use of glucose sparing prescriptions (PEN vs Dianeal) in diabetic (Type 1 and Type 2) Continuous Ambulatory Peritoneal Dialysis (CAPD)and Automated Peritoneal Dialysis (APD) patients leads to improved metabolic control as measured by the magnitude of change from the baseline value in the HbA1c levels.

Secondary Objectives: To demonstrate that use of glucose-sparing PD solutions (PEN vs Dianeal) in diabetic (Type 1 and Type 2) CAPD and APD patients leads to lower glycemic-control medication requirements, decreased incidence of severe hypoglycemic events requiring medical intervention, improved metabolic control, nutritional status, and Quality of Life. In a subgroup of patients, the impact of glucose-sparing PD solutions (PEN vs Dianeal only) on abdominal fat and left ventricular (LV) structure and function will be assessed.

入选标准

  • M/F patients 18 years of age or older
  • Diagnosis of ESRD (GFR ≤ 15 mL/min)
  • CAPD or APD using only Dianeal and/or Physioneal, at least 1 exchange of 2.5% or 4.25% dextrose/day, no prescribed dry time
  • DM (Type 1 and 2) on glycemic-control medication, for 90 days
  • HbA1c > 6.0% but ≤ 12.0%
  • Blood hemoglobin ≥ 8.0 g/dL, but ≤ 13.0 g/dL

排除标准

  • Cardiovascular event within the last 90 days
  • Ongoing clinically significant congestive heart failure (NYHA class III or IV)
  • Allergy to starch-based polymers
  • Glycogen storage disease
  • Glycogen storage disease
  • Peritonitis, exit-site or tunnel infection treated with antibiotics within last 30 days
  • Mean Arterial Pressure (MAP) ≥ 125 mm Hg, or volume depleted (MAP < 77) at Screening.
  • Serum urea > 30 mmol/L
  • Receiving rosiglitazone maleate

结局指标

主要结局

Change From the Baseline Value in HbA1c at Month 3 and 6

时间窗: Baseline, Month 3, Month 6 (End of Study)

HbA1c is a specific glycohemoglobin, and adduct of glucose attached to the beta-chain terminal valine residue. Measured using a Tina-quant immunological assay suitable for samples from end stage renal disease (ESRD) patients and with icodextrin metabolites or equivalent. Statistical analysis includes estimates of Least Squares (LS) comparing differences between treatment groups by visit and p-value using analysis of covariance (ANOVA) testing that the differences=0.
